TCP自ポート番号自動割り当てのポート番号が65535を超えると0になる
Cente Non-OS TCP/IPv4 Ver.1.01
Cente Non-OS TCP/IPv4 Ver.1.01
新規作成
・ping送信機能の追加
ping送信機能を追加した
・FTPc対応を追加
Cente Non-OS FTPc(別パッケージ)へ対応した
・tcp送受信長の変更
cntcp_write(), cntcp_read() cntcp_read_max(), cntcp_read_line()のlenを、u16_tからu32_tへ変更した
・エフェメラルポートの変更
TCPのエフェメラルポート番号の範囲を、4096~32767から、49152~65535へ変更した
・LANドライバ受信処理の修正
LANドライバの受信データをPBUF_LINKからPBUF_RAWに修正した
・cntcpip_pools.hの修正
メモリ確保で、1514バイトを1532バイトに修正した
・リスニングソケットの修正
リスニングソケットクローズ時にメモリ破壊の可能性があったのを修正した
・メモリリークの修正
Out Of SequenceなTCPセグメントと、TCP切断処理中の受信処理に、メモリリークの可能性があったのを修正した